a clear listing
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"a clear listing"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when referring to a well-organized and easily understandable enumeration of items or information. Example: "The report included a clear listing of all the expenses incurred during the project."

Linguistic Context
A clear listing serves as a noun phrase that typically functions as an object or complement within a sentence. As seen in Ludwig, it refers to an organized and easily understandable enumeration of items or information. The phrase indicates that the information is not only presented but also easily accessible.

FAQs
How can I use "a clear listing" in a sentence?
You can use "a clear listing" when you want to present information in an organized and easily understandable manner, like "The website provides "a clear listing" of available services".
What is an alternative to "a clear listing"?
Alternatives to "a clear listing" include "a well-defined list", "a transparent inventory", or "an explicit enumeration", depending on the specific nuance you want to convey.
When is it appropriate to use "a clear listing"?
It's appropriate to use "a clear listing" when you need to present items, features, or steps in a way that is easy to understand and follow. This is especially useful in instructional materials, product descriptions, and service offerings.
How does "a clear listing" differ from a regular list?
"A clear listing" implies that the information is not only listed but also presented in a way that is easily understood and free from ambiguity. It emphasizes the clarity and organization of the list.
